Relocating your vehicle across cities can seem daunting, but with a little planning and knowledge, it doesn't have to be. Here's a comprehensive guide to help you navigate the process seamlessly. First, figure out your car transport goals. Consider factors such as distance, timeline, budget, and any special preferences you may have.
- Next, research different vehicle carriers to find one that fits your needs. Look for a reputable company with positive customer reviews and experience in handling interstate shipments.
- Once you've selected a copyright, obtain a shipping agreement. Ensure the quote covers all relevant costs, such as loading, unloading, insurance, and any additional charges.
- Organize your vehicle for transport by cleaning it thoroughly. Remove any personal belongings or valuable items.
- Schedule the pickup and delivery dates with the transport company. Provide them with accurate contact information and drop-off locations.
- On the day of pickup, inspect your vehicle carefully before handing it over to the transporter representative. Document any existing damage to avoid potential disputes later.
- Monitor your shipment's progress using the tracking code provided by the transport company.
- Upon arrival, examine your vehicle again for any new damage. Notify the transport company immediately if you find any issues.
In conclusion, remember to preserve all documentation related to your car transport, including quotes, contracts, and receipts. This will be helpful in case of any future inquiries or disputes.

Transporting Your Car Across Country: A Comprehensive Guide
Auto shipping requires careful planning and research to ensure a smooth and seamless journey. Whether you're transporting for work, pleasure, or various reason, understanding the complete process can alleviate stress and provide peace of mind. This article outlines the essential steps involved in auto shipping, from selecting a reputable copyright to final delivery, guiding you through each stage with clarity and accuracy.
First and foremost, explore different auto shipping options available. Open carriers offer varying car shipping process steps levels of protection and price, while door-to-door service delivers ultimate convenience. Get quotes from multiple carriers to compare pricing, services, and insurance coverage.
- Think about the distance needed. Longer hauls typically result higher shipping costs.
- Verify the copyright's licensing and insurance to confirm they meet industry standards.
- Examine online reviews and customer testimonials to gauge their reputation.
Once you select a copyright, provide them with precise information about your vehicle, including its make, model, year, VIN number, and current location. Schedule a pickup date that accommodates your needs.
Prepare your car for shipping by removing any personal belongings and attaching loose items. Take photographs of the vehicle's condition before transport.
Throughout the shipping process, retain open communication with the copyright to track your car's movement. Upon arrival, review the vehicle thoroughly for any damages and document them immediately.
